US rappers shot dead
Washington, June 19
Two US rappers, XXXTentacion and Jimmy Wopo, were killed on Monday in shootings near Miami and in Pittsburgh.
In Florida, the Broward County sheriff's office said XXXTentacion, 20, was shot while leaving a motor sports dealership in Deerfield Beach. Two men fled the scene in a SUV after one of them opened fire, striking the rapper, whose real name was Jahseh Dwayne Onfroy, in what investigators said appeared to be a robbery bid. XXXTentacion released his debut album in August 2017. His second album “?” debuted at No.1 on the Billboard 200 chart when it was released in March.
In another incident, Wopo, 21, whose real name was Travon Smart, died after a double shooting in Pittsburgh. His manager Taylor Maglin wrote on Facebook, “I lost my brother. He was destined for greatness and he wanted the best for his friends, family and community.” — Reuters
